Abstract
According to embodiment, the invention discloses a treadmill lifting regulating method, a regulating device and a treadmill, and relates to the field of intelligent hardware, aiming at solving the problem of an existing treadmill which cannot be subjected to lifting regulating timely in the running process of a user. According to the embodiment, the method disclosed by the invention comprises the following steps: acquiring data information of an application scene when APP displayed on the treadmill is operated; analyzing a topographic condition of the current application scene in accordance with the data information; and regulating lifting of the treadmill in accordance with the topographic condition of the current application scene. The embodiment of the invention is mainly applicable to the automatic lifting regulating of the treadmill in accordance with the application scene of the APP on the treadmill; and running interesting can be enhanced.
